    Speaking of target sights...

    I have a small problem with a couple of P-H sights. When I screw in the variable aperture (PH59) eyepiece it stops with the little adjusting wheel at six o'clock where I can't get at it. Does anyone have a neat trick to fix this? Tape in the threads maybe?

    If it were me, I'd try a small o-ring over the threaded stem to limit the depth, maybe a brass washer if you find the right thickness. I have the same issue on mine ;^)

    Little fiber washers come in all sorts of sizes and thicknesses and if you're almost spot on but not quite they will compress and allow just a bit more more turn. they also feel 'right' as you turn the pressure on, and they remain undo-able by finger at the end of a days shooting, important for me as I often switch my iris apertures and ph 60's across rifles during the day.
